The best time to visit Adilabad is during the winter months, from October to March. The weather during this period is pleasant and cool, making it ideal for sightseeing and outdoor activities. The temperature ranges from 15°C to 30°C, providing a comfortable environment for exploring the natural beauty and historical sites of Adilabad. Avoiding the summer months (April to June) is advisable, as temperatures can soar, making it challenging to enjoy the attractions. The monsoon season (July to September) brings heavy rainfall, which can disrupt travel plans and limit outdoor activities. Therefore, planning your trip between October and March ensures a more enjoyable and comfortable experience in Adilabad.
